Transaction 8ef61cf24e3311835a19dd574fd2a50a5d532a8ea135199848d6d84382d7025b
1 Input
1 Output
-
8ef61cf24e3311835a19dd574fd2a50a5d532a8ea135199848d6d84382d7025b:0
- value
- 1675
- script pubkey
- OP_0 OP_PUSHBYTES_20 f3b9971b45f305904d4df2995df6af03eb1526c6
- address
- bc1q7wuewx697vzeqn2d72v4ma40q0432fkx2kgt04